全球低温运输产品市场预计将从 2025 年的 3,084.4 亿美元成长到 2031 年的 6,377.4 亿美元,复合年增长率达到 12.87%。
该市场涵盖了维持食品、饮料和药品等生鲜产品特定温度条件所需的综合基础设施、专业运输和保温包装解决方案。推动这一增长的关键因素包括生鲜食品国际贸易量的增长以及各地消费者对新鲜优质农产品日益增长的需求。根据全球低温运输联盟 (GCC) 预测,到 2025 年,其成员公司将管理总合81.6 亿立方英尺的温控仓储能力,较去年同期成长超过 10%。这凸显了建立强大的物流网络以支援温控货物运输的迫切需求。

儘管前景光明,但高耗能的冷藏保管和运输系统带来的高昂营运成本,对市场扩张构成重大挑战。能源价格波动以及基础建设所需的大量资金,会严重影响获利能力,尤其是在电力供应不稳定的发展中地区。这些财务负担往往限制了小规模物流业者升级设施的能力,导致全球供应链出现瓶颈。
生物製药和疫苗物流的快速扩张是推动市场发展的主要动力。这主要源自于生物製药日益复杂的特性以及对精准温度控制的需求。随着製药公司将重点转向细胞和基因疗法等高价值、对温度敏感的治疗方法,物流供应商正大力投资专业基础设施,以确保产品在全球供应链中的完整性。儘管经济波动普遍,但该产业的韧性依然显着。根据《货运机场与航空服务》2025年6月刊的预测,2024年医药航空货运量预计将成长2%,显示成长动能正在復苏。这一增长凸显了医疗用品在时效性运输方面对航空货运的持续依赖,因此,先进的主动和被动包装解决方案对于防止运输过程中的温度偏差至关重要。
同时,开发中国家为减少收穫后损失并支持出口活动,正推动生鲜食品贸易和供应链日益全球化。这种全球化需要强大的仓储和运输能力来应对生鲜食品运输时间的延长。例如,根据Ecofin Agency于2025年10月报道,马士基在南非开设了一个新的冷藏仓库,这是其在南非投资1亿美元用于低温运输物流网络现代化改造的一部分。此外,该领域的投资规模也反映在主要企业企业Lineage的绩效上。 Lineage于2025年2月宣布,2024年全年销售额达53亿美元,凸显了温控仓储服务所创造的巨大价值。
维护高能耗冷藏仓库和运输系统所需的高昂营运成本是市场扩张的主要障碍。维持精确的温度控制需要持续的能源消耗,而物流业者还需应对不断波动的公用事业费用。随着这些营运成本的上升,缺乏财力承担这些成本或投资于现代化节能技术的小规模本地业者受到的影响尤其严重。这种财务差距造成了市场两极化,成长集中在少数几家主导营运商手中,而服务不足的地区则面临空白。
这种整合将限制全球供应链的柔软性,并阻碍竞争。根据全球低温运输联盟2025年4月发布的报告,全球排名前25位的营运商控制着73亿立方英尺的温控仓储能力,这凸显了与小规模的竞争对手分散的资源之间存在的显着不平衡。这种市场集中度表明,高额的资本障碍有效地阻止了小规模业者的扩张。因此,建构强大且如同毛细血管般覆盖全球的物流网络(对于确保发展中国家的食品安全和药品供应至关重要)正受到阻碍。
在冷藏仓库中采用自动化立体仓库系统 (ASRS) 是库存管理领域的一项变革性趋势,它能够最大限度地提高储存密度,并降低低温环境下的人事费用。这种自动化解决了产业面临的一项关键挑战:技术纯熟劳工。它还能确保产品处理的一致性,并减少取货过程中的温度波动,从而满足易腐货物保质至关重要的要求。根据《世界货运新闻》2025年11月报道,马士基在上海开设了一座旗舰设施,配备了先进的ASRS和堆垛机起重机,这是其1.4亿美元投资计画的一部分,旨在为亚太地区的客户提供支援。
同时,随着物流业者努力减少一次性塑胶和发泡聚苯乙烯(EPS)对环境的影响,向可生物降解、可重复使用和永续的保温包装解决方案的转型正在加速。在严格的法规结构和企业永续性目标的推动下,这项转变促使企业在温控货柜中实施循环经济模式,同时又不影响保温性能。根据DCAT发布的《2025年4月价值链洞察报告》,DHL集团已在其20亿欧元的策略投资计画中拨出一部分资金,专门用于加强其全球网路中的被动和主动包装能力,以实现永续永续性。
The Global Cold Chain Products Market is projected to expand from USD 308.44 Billion in 2025 to USD 637.74 Billion by 2031, achieving a CAGR of 12.87%. This market encompasses the integrated infrastructure, specialized transport, and thermal packaging solutions required to preserve specific temperature conditions for perishable items like food, beverages, and pharmaceuticals. Key drivers fueling this growth include the rising volume of international trade in perishables and a fundamental increase in consumer demand for fresh, high-quality produce across various regions. According to the Global Cold Chain Alliance, member companies collectively managed 8.16 billion cubic feet of temperature-controlled capacity in 2025, marking a growth of over 10 percent from the previous year, which underscores the critical need for robust logistics networks to support the movement of temperature-sensitive commodities.

Despite this positive outlook, high operational costs associated with energy-intensive cold storage and transport systems pose a significant challenge to broader market expansion. The volatility of energy prices and the substantial capital needed for infrastructure development can severely impact profit margins, particularly in developing regions with unreliable power grids. This financial strain often restricts the ability of smaller logistics providers to upgrade their facilities, thereby creating bottlenecks within the global supply chain.
Market Driver
The rapid expansion of biopharmaceutical and vaccine logistics serves as a primary catalyst for market development, driven by the increasing complexity of biologic drugs and the requirement for precise thermal management. As pharmaceutical companies pivot toward high-value, temperature-sensitive therapies such as cell and gene treatments, logistics providers are investing heavily in specialized infrastructure to guarantee product integrity throughout global supply chains. This sector's resilience is evident despite broader economic fluctuations; according to Cargo Airports & Airline Services in June 2025, pharmaceutical air cargo tonnages rose by 2% in 2024, signaling a return to growth. This increase highlights the continued reliance on air freight for time-critical medical shipments, necessitating advanced active and passive packaging solutions to prevent temperature excursions during transit.
Simultaneously, the increasing globalization of perishable food trade and supply chains significantly propels the industry, as developing nations modernize their food supply networks to reduce post-harvest losses and support export activities. This globalization demands robust storage and transport capabilities to accommodate longer transit times for fresh produce. For instance, the Ecofin Agency reported in October 2025 that Maersk opened a new cold storage warehouse in South Africa as part of a $100 million investment to modernize the country's cold-chain logistics network. Furthermore, the scale of financial commitment in the sector is reflected in the performance of major players like Lineage, Inc., which reported full-year 2024 revenue of $5.3 billion in February 2025, underscoring the substantial value generated by temperature-controlled warehousing services.
Market Challenge
The substantial operational expenditure required to maintain energy-intensive cold storage and transport systems presents a significant barrier to broader market development. Maintaining precise temperature controls demands continuous energy consumption, exposing logistics providers to volatile utility prices. When these operational expenses rise, they disproportionately impact smaller regional providers who lack the financial reserves to absorb such costs or invest in modern, energy-efficient technologies. This financial disparity creates a polarized market where growth is concentrated among a few dominant entities, leaving gaps in service for underserved regions.
This consolidation limits the flexibility of the global supply chain and stifles competition. According to the Global Cold Chain Alliance in April 2025, the top 25 global operators controlled 7.3 billion cubic feet of temperature-controlled capacity, highlighting a significant imbalance compared to the fragmented resources available to smaller competitors. Such market concentration indicates that high capital barriers are effectively preventing smaller players from scaling their operations. Consequently, this hampers the establishment of robust, capillary logistics networks needed to ensure consistent food security and pharmaceutical access in developing markets.
Market Trends
The deployment of automated storage and retrieval systems (ASRS) in cold warehouses is a transformative trend reshaping inventory management by maximizing storage density and reducing reliance on manual labor in sub-zero environments. This automation addresses the critical industry shortage of skilled workers while ensuring consistent product handling and reduced thermal fluctuations during retrieval processes, which is essential for maintaining the quality of sensitive perishables. According to WorldCargo News in November 2025, Maersk inaugurated a flagship facility in Shanghai featuring advanced ASRS and stacker cranes as part of a US$140 million investment to support customers in the Asia-Pacific region.
Concurrently, the transition towards biodegradable and reusable sustainable thermal packaging solutions is gaining momentum as logistics providers strive to minimize the environmental footprint of single-use plastics and expanded polystyrene (EPS). This shift is driven by stringent regulatory frameworks and corporate sustainability goals, pushing companies to adopt circular economy models for their temperature-controlled containers without compromising thermal performance. According to DCAT Value Chain Insights in April 2025, DHL Group allocated a portion of its EUR 2 billion strategic investment plan specifically to enhancing both passive and active packaging capabilities for sustainability across its global network.
